NDEWO! Umu Igbo Unite- Austin Chapter ("UIU-Austin"), chartered in 2018, is a local chapter of the national Umu Igbo Unite organization. Umu Igbo Unite is a U.S.-based, 501(c)(3) non-profit organization that consists of a wide range of professionals and college students of Nigerian Igbo heritage who reside in the United States.
